From: Failure load of the femoral insertion site of the anterior cruciate ligament in a porcine model: comparison of different portions and knee flexion angles

Fig. 1

The porcine femoral ACL insertion site and classification of the insertion area. a The femoral ACL attachment is divided into the following 4 areas: anterior half of anteromedial bundle (AMB) (a-AMB), posterior half of AMB (p-AMB), anterior half of posterolateral bundle (PLB) (a-PLB), and posterior half of PLB (p-PLB). b The 3-mm square attachment in the center of each bundle was left for the pull-out tests. This photo shows the a-AMB group
